A black truck struck a car, the struck a pole knocking down wires, according to our crew on scene.
FIRST REPORT:
We are hearing reports of an accident involving a truck and a car in the 3600 block of New Carlisle Pike.
Crews are just now arriving on scene of the incident that was reported at 10:39 a.m., according to the Springfield Post of the Ohio State Highway Patrol.
Initial reports indicate the car struck a pole and power lines are down.
